Ver Mensaje Individual
  #6  
Antiguo 10-10-2007
Avatar de Ivanzinho
[Ivanzinho] Ivanzinho is offline
Miembro Premium
 
Registrado: ene 2005
Ubicación: Galicia
Posts: 595
Reputación: 22
Ivanzinho Va por buen camino
Cita:
Empezado por Gabo Ver Mensaje
Y si, siguiendo con el ejemplo, no deseo agrupar por el nombre, ¿valdría hacerlo así?

Código SQL [-]SELECT A.CODIGO, SUM(B.CANTIDAD), A. NOMBRE FROM A, B
WHERE A.CODIGO=B.CODIGO GROUP BY A.CODIGO


Voy a probarlo, ya que en realidad sólo necesito agrupar por el código, pero si necesito el resto de los datos.

Gracias por tu respuesta.
Si no quieres agrupar por el nombre no lo incluyas en la consulta, porque no sé que sentido tiene que quieras sumar un campo y mostrar otro por el que no agrupes, ya que en este caso el sum daría como resultado siempre 1, ya que la consulta te devolvería un registro por cada registro de la tabla.

¿Por qué no nos dices lo que quieres conseguir para poder ayudarte mejor?, porque lo de querer obtener un acumulado por un campo que no agrupas no tiene mucho sentido, ya que el resultado como te dije anteriormente sería siempre 1.

Un saúdo, y espero poder ayudarte.
__________________
Si no lees esto no vivirás tranquilo
Non lle poñades chatas â obra namentras non se remata. O que pense que vai mal que traballe n’ela; hai sitio para todos. (Castelao)
Responder Con Cita